Dr. Wang says that unsaturated fatty acids in food help regulate blood lipids and lower "bad" cholesterol levels while increasing "good" cholesterol.

Dr. Wong emphasises that high-fibre foods are also a good choice for lowering blood lipids. At the same time, it is also recommended that we limit our own intake of foods high in sugar and salt. Dr. Wang reminds that moderate exercise is also a key factor in controlling blood lipids.
